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/qt/6.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Qt 控制程序条宽度_Qt_Qt Creator_Qprogressbar - Fatal编程技术网

Qt 控制程序条宽度

Qt 控制程序条宽度,qt,qt-creator,qprogressbar,Qt,Qt Creator,Qprogressbar,我有一个垂直QProgressBar,它位于两个QTextEdit对象之间的水平布局中。在Designer中,我使用样式表更改了进度条的宽度,这在一定程度上是可行的,但我不能将宽度缩小到17像素以下。我希望它非常窄-可能在5px左右-但在Designer中更改样式表和最小大小不会将其更改为如此窄。您可以通过多种方式更改任何小部件的大小: 设计器-在设计器窗体中,您将在几何图形下找到宽度字段。在此处设置要设置的宽度 代码-Qt中的大多数(如果不是所有预定义小部件的话)都有许多可访问的函数,或者可能

我有一个垂直QProgressBar,它位于两个QTextEdit对象之间的水平布局中。在Designer中,我使用样式表更改了进度条的宽度,这在一定程度上是可行的,但我不能将宽度缩小到17像素以下。我希望它非常窄-可能在5px左右-但在Designer中更改样式表和最小大小不会将其更改为如此窄。

您可以通过多种方式更改任何小部件的大小:

设计器-在设计器窗体中,您将在
几何图形
下找到宽度字段。在此处设置要设置的宽度

代码-Qt中的大多数(如果不是所有预定义小部件的话)都有许多可访问的函数,或者可能有用

请记住,根据最新执行的语句,在代码中设置的内容通常优先于设计器中的值


PS-我尝试过通过样式表设置大小,但没有成功。我认为这可能不可靠。

我在designer中更改了宽度字段的值,而不是样式表。它对我有用。另外,如何更改样式表的宽度?我不想那样做。。